Orson L. Rundio 1946-2026
HUBBARD — Orson L. Rundio, 79, passed away peacefully at home on Thursday, Feb. 19, 2026.
Orson was born Dec. 8, 1946, in Columbus, a son of Joseph F. Rundio and Martha Wanena Ferris.
He was a supply house worker at the Vienna Air Base for several years.
Orson was a proud veteran of the United States Navy, serving during the Vietnam War, and for 17 years was a member of the Army National Guard. He also was a member of the VFW in Columbus.
